The fact that the Junior dinner will not take place until March 30 is no reason why the majority of the class of Ninety-eight should delay signing the blue-book at Leavitt and Peirce's and securing their tickets until the day before the dinner. In past years this has been the case with a considerable number of Juniors and on account of not knowing how many to provide for, the committee on arrangements has always had an unnecessary amount of trouble at the last minute. Thus far a ridiculously small percentage of the class has signified its intention of attending the dinner; certainly it is not asking too much of those men who are reasonably sure of being present to say so at once and thus save much unnecessary trouble.
